A story about Emilie who faces the guy who raped her, Simon, on a night out. To her surprise, he doesn't seem to recognize her. She decides to take matters into her own hands and finally get her revenge, but the situation quickly spirals out of control. Simon will suffer the consequences of his actions, but so will Emilie. What has only been a vengeful fantasy in her mind is now real. How can Emilie keep her cool, while the adrenaline is pumping? And how can she confront Simon, when he's the root of her trauma? Good Girl is a short film about revenge, power and sexual assault.
